AssistRx, Inc. is looking to support the strategy, development, and optimization of patient support offerings by analyzing performance, identifying opportunities, and informing product decisions with data-driven insights.

Requirements

  • Strong proficiency in Excel, SQL, and data visualization tools (e.g., Tableau, Power BI).
  • Familiarity with product management tools (e.g., Jira, Confluence) and Agile methodologies.
  • Experience in life sciences, healthcare, or patient services preferred.
  • Str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and a deep understanding of healthcare workflows and compliance standards.
  • Bachelor’s degree in life sciences, business, data analytics, or related field.
  • 2–4 years of experience in product analysis, business analysis, or healthcare operations.
  • Experience with HIPAA, 21 CFR Part 11 compliance

Responsibilities

  • Analyze product usage, operational performance, and patient outcomes across digital and service-based offerings.
  • Develop dashboards and reports to track KPIs such as time-to-therapy, patient retention, program adoption, and client satisfaction
  • Support competitive analysis, market research, and client feedback synthesis to inform roadmap prioritization.
  • Assist in preparing business cases and opportunity assessments for new features or service enhancements.
  • Translate business needs into clear product requirements, user stories, and process flows.
  • Maintain product documentation, including feature specs, SOPs, and compliance checklists.
  • Work with data science, engineering, and operations teams to validate hypotheses and support product experiments.
